有关圣诞节的英语口语表达

Stocking stuffer

圣诞小礼物

含义:小礼物,尤其指放在圣诞长袜里的小礼物

Mary went to the store today to look for some stocking stuffers for the children.

玛丽今天去商店给孩子们找一些小礼物。

To trim the tree

装饰圣诞树

含义:用丝带、彩灯、饰品等装饰圣诞树

My family usually trims the Christmas tree with red and green lights and wooden ornaments.

我们家通常用红绿灯和木制装饰品装饰圣诞树。

White Christmas

白色圣诞节

含义:下雪的圣诞节

In London seldom do we get a white Christmas.

在伦敦,圣诞节很少下雪。

The holiday spirit

节日气氛

含义:关于假日的激动兴奋

December isn't here yet and I'm already feeling the holiday spirit.

十二月还没到,我已经感受到了节日的气氛。

Be my guest

请自便

含义:一种礼貌的方式,让某人知道他们自己可以随意自便

Do you mind if I get that last piece of the fruit cake? Be my guest.

你介意我吃最后一块水果蛋糕吗?

请便。

Don't look a gift horse in the mouth

不要挑剔别人的礼物

含义:要对你收到的礼物感恩。

Oh no, I don’t like historical novels.

Don't look a gift horse in the mouth.

哦,不,我不喜欢历史小说。

别太挑剔了。

To beat the holiday blues

赶走节日忧虑

含义:克服由于假期准备或假期过后需要恢复正常生活而产生的压力和沮丧,(大概是假期综合症~)

When I want to beat the holiday blues I always think about the fact that soon it will be over.

当我想赶走节日忧虑时,我总会想它很快就结束了。

Good things come in small packages

好东西都是小包装的

含义:礼物不应该以尺寸来衡量,因为有时候最小的礼物是最好的

At first I was saddened by the size of my gift, but I thought to myself that good things come in small packages. I was not mistaken, because inside there were keys to a new car!

起初我对自己礼物的尺寸大小感到难过,但我心里想,好东西总是小包装的。我没弄错,因为里面有新车的钥匙!

Christmas comes but once a year

佳节良辰,一年一次

含义:圣诞节一年一度,我们应该尽情地享受它,经常被用作多花钱或沉溺于美食的借口。

Sue do you want another piece of the cake? Sure, why not? Christmas comes but once a year.

苏,你还要一块蛋糕吗?当然,为什么不呢?圣诞节一年只有一次。

Christmas came early (this year)

收到了好消息

含义:当某人收到意想不到的好消息时

Did you hear that Janice is pregnant? Christmas came early this year for her and Matthew.

你听说珍妮丝怀孕了吗?对她和马修而言真是个好消息。

The more the merrier

多多益善

含义:人越多,情况越好。

Can I bring my girlfriend to the holiday party?

Sure, the more the merrier.

我可以带女朋友去参加假日聚会吗?

当然,人越多越好。

Be there with bells on

非常乐意去...

含义:应邀时说的话,意思是你会很乐意去。

Mom, will you come to my Christmas play at school? Of course, I will be there with bells on.

妈妈,你能来学校看我的圣诞剧吗?当然,我很乐意去。

与圣诞节有关的英语口语表达

1.圣诞快乐!

Merry Christmas!

2.请代我向布莱恩表达我的圣诞祝愿。

Please send my Christmas greetings to Brian。

3.这是给你的圣诞礼物。

This is a Christmas present for you。

4.愿女儿的祝福带给您快乐。

Christmas greetings from your daughter to cheer you up。

5.祝世界上最好的父母圣诞快乐!

Merry Christmas to the world's best parents!

6.向我慈爱的父母致以节日的问候!

Season's greetings to my nice parents!

7.在此佳节之际,我向您和您的家人致以最美好的祝福!

Best wishes for you and your family during this holiday season!

8.给我最好的朋友送去圣诞祝福!

Christmas wishes for my best friend!

9.愿你拥有圣诞佳节所有美好的祝福。

Wish you all the blessings of a beautiful Christmas season。

10.希望你能及时收到这张圣诞贺卡。

I hope this card reaches you in time for Christmas。

11.节日快乐!

Happy holiday!
